Position Description

The Upstream Senior Research Scientist (Technical Development) directly supports Elanco’s Technical Development (TD) organization in its mission to develop and deliver Innovation, Characterization, and Process Control. The primary responsibilities of this role are to support the upstream (mammalian cell culture) scientific team by developing, optimizing, and characterizing cell culture processes that produce recombinant vaccines, proteins, and antibodies. This role supports upstream lab activities within the broad scope of Elanco’s large molecule portfolio with initial emphasis on delivering Elanco’s therapeutic monoclonal antibody platforms.

Functions, Duties, and Tasks

  • Lead a small group (1–3) scientists and ensure team members are growing scientifically and professionally through direct and indirect coaching and mentorship

  • Technical program leadership

  • Incorporate safety and quality into process development

  • Incorporate DoE-based approaches into design and analysis of cell culture experiments

  • Collaborate with internal and external partners and technology transfer with manufacturing partners

  • Author, review, and execute protocols, batch records, and technical reports

  • Provide subject matter expertise to mammalian cell culture processes and seed train expansion, leveraging knowledge and experience to accelerate and optimize protein production

  • Introduce new techniques and technologies to the TD organization and maintain awareness of advancements in the field and competitive landscape

  • Conduct prospective capacity planning and program planning for resources under supervision
